Output 86852f743d2c1c59e1ff9630072e25446fd072dfee20eb7b1f617cd6fc084126:17

value
4173093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6319dd0aa835d7fbc29978d6f23ed68969e263f6 OP_EQUAL
address
3Aj1oZMDGDKqaqcvh7qWUqvFK8T2Y62Am3
transaction
86852f743d2c1c59e1ff9630072e25446fd072dfee20eb7b1f617cd6fc084126